Black sesame stir-frying equipment for black sesame pill production
The multi-motor driven stirring system and guide roller design solve the problems of slow discharging and sticking in the black sesame pill production equipment, achieve fast and uniform feeding and stir-frying effects, and improve the practicality and processing efficiency of the equipment.

[0001] The utility model relates to the technical field of black sesame frying, in particular to black sesame frying equipment for producing black sesame pills. Background Art
[0002] Black sesame is the black seed of Sesame family, also known as sesame, oil sesame, giant sesame, fat sesame, etc. Black sesame can be used as both medicine and food. It has the effects of nourishing the liver and kidneys, nourishing the five internal organs, benefiting the essence and blood, and moisturizing the intestines. It is regarded as a nourishing holy product. Modern nutritional research shows that the calcium content of 100g of black sesame is about 800mg, which is more than 8 times that of milk. Moreover, it is better released after being fried and easier to absorb. In the processing of black sesame pills, black sesame needs to be fried.
[0003] In the prior art, a black sesame frying device for producing black sesame pills discharges the black sesame seeds from a discharge pipe by tilting the barrel during feeding. This discharge method is slow due to the size of the discharge pipe. In addition, the black sesame seeds may stick to the inner wall of the barrel during frying, resulting in insufficient feeding and poor practicality. Utility Model Content

[0024] Working principle: When the device is used, black sesame seeds are poured into the barrel 2 through the feeding pipe 16, and the heating plate 12 is operated to heat the barrel 2. The second motor 8 is operated to drive the stirring shaft 9 to rotate, thereby driving the stirring rod 10 and the shovel plate 11 to rotate, so as to stir-fry the black sesame seeds in the barrel 2. The third motor 19 is then operated to drive the first gear 20 to rotate. The second gear 21 cooperates to drive the barrel 2 as a whole to rotate in the opposite direction of the stirring shaft 9, so that the black sesame seeds inside the barrel are stir-fried more evenly. After the stir-frying is completed, the first motor 6 is operated to drive one of the connecting columns 4 to rotate. Through the cooperation of another connecting column 4, the ring 3 is driven to rotate, thereby driving the barrel 2 to adjust its angle and tilt it. Then, through the operation of the telescopic rod 14, the top cover 15 is driven to move, so that one end of the barrel 2 is fully opened, and the material is discharged faster. The operation of the second motor 8 drives the stirring shaft 9 to rotate, thereby driving the stirring rod 10 and the shovel plate 11 to rotate. When the shovel plate 11 rotates, it will scrape off the black sesame seeds sticking to the inner wall of the barrel 2, so that the material discharge is more uniform and more practical. In addition, the device is provided with a guide roller 23, which makes it convenient for the storage box to move more conveniently after loading and unloading the black sesame seeds through the guidance of the guide roller 23.
